Endowment Opportunities

An endowment is a long-term investment in the university, held in perpetuity, that will provide scholarships, support funds, and other benefits to students and faculty year after year. Because the gift principal is invested and only a portion of the income is spent, a donor who creates an endowed gift today can be confident that it will grow and continue to support UAB in the years to come.
